No, hospital insurance for individuals is not mandatory. However, it can provide significant financial protection in case of unexpected medical emergencies.
In recent years, hospital insurance for individuals has gained attention in the US due to the increasing financial burden of medical expenses. With medical costs rising by 5.2% annually, many individuals are finding themselves struggling to afford even basic care. Hospital insurance for individuals provides a safety net, shielding policyholders from the financial shock of medical emergencies.

Hospital insurance for individuals offers several advantages, including:
Hospital insurance for individuals works by providing financial protection against unexpected hospital bills. When a policyholder receives medical care at a participating hospital, the insurance company pays a portion of the costs, leaving the policyholder with significantly reduced financial liability. Policyholders typically pay a monthly premium in exchange for this coverage. The specific terms and conditions of hospital insurance for individuals vary depending on the provider and policy chosen.
